Transaction 3e11591976a3086de3c61a2eb9f887ceb0d343bb4632bd2bffe5ffc197e15f3a

3 Input
2 Outputs
  • 3e11591976a3086de3c61a2eb9f887ceb0d343bb4632bd2bffe5ffc197e15f3a:0
  • value  1026264
    address  3PqyBhrkLeqC6rZnnn5Ue1yZyr5xUYogeK
  • 3e11591976a3086de3c61a2eb9f887ceb0d343bb4632bd2bffe5ffc197e15f3a:1
  • value  3089594
    address  bc1q8dm5zneetw8hfpcdm8sgpamhvvsqz4mtrvc42c